可锐资源网

技术资源分享平台,提供编程学习、网站建设、脚本开发教程

一次完整的HTTP请求与响应涉及了哪些知识?

本文以HTTP请求和响应的过程来讲解涉及到的相关知识点。

一、 HTTP请求和响应步骤

图片来自:理解Http请求与响应以上完整表示了HTTP请求和响应的7个步骤,下面从TCP/IP协议模型的角度来理解HTTP请求和响应如何传递的。

二、TCP/IP协议

TCP/IP协议模型(Transmission Control Protocol/Internet Protocol),包含了一系列构成互联网基础的网络协议,是Internet的核心协议,通过20多年的发展已日渐成熟,并被广泛应用于局域网和广域网中,目前已成为事实上的国际标准。TCP/IP协议簇是一组不同层次上的多个协议的组合,通常被认为是一个四层协议系统,与OSI的七层模型相对应。

[西门子PLC]组态王6.55如何通过TCP添加西门子1200设备

最近我用组态王来采集设备的数据,这设备的控制器是西门子的 1214CPU 呢。一边操作一边记录,下面就是我在组态王里添加西门子 1200PLC 的笔记。


组态王软件介绍!

组态王软件是一种常见的工业监控软件,它把过程控制设计、现场操作还有工厂资源管理都给融合到一块儿了,把一个企业里面的各种生产系统、应用以及信息交流都汇集到了一起,实现了最优管理。它是基于 Microsoft Windows

WordPress做301重定向,其实比你想得简单多了

讲真,很多人一听“301重定向”这五个字,脑子里立马冒出一堆问号:“是不是得写代码?”“是不是得改服务器配置?”“不会搞坏我网站吧?”——放心,咱今天就把这个事说清楚,而且不整那些让人头疼的技术术语。

只要你的网站是用WordPress建的,不管是B2B独立站、电商产品页,还是内容型博客,搞定301重定向,真的就几分钟的事。

我今天这篇文章,就当是手把手陪你搞定这个“看着复杂其实很友好”的事儿。我们不聊术语,只聊操作。你只需要跟着我,一步一步来。

宝塔实测-PHP网页版在线客服系统源码

大家好啊,我是测评君,欢迎来到web测评。

[汇川PLC] 汇川整数相除求取余数的指令MOD

汇川plc取余运算

汇川plc取余运算用于获取除法运算后的余数。

它在汇川plc编程中是重要的数学运算类型。取余运算符号在汇川plc中为“MOD”。基本运算格式是被除数MOD除数。例如10 MOD 3,结果为1。取余运算能判断一个数能否被另一个数整除。若余数为0,表明被除数能被除数整除。这一运算可用于处理周期性任务。比如在控制电机按特定周期运行方面。

PHP命名空间概念解析

1. PHP中的命名空间是什么?

什么是命名空间?“从广义上来说,命名空间是一种封装事物的方法。在很多地方都可以见到这种抽象概念。例如,在操作系统中目录用来将相关文件分组,对于目录中的文件来说,它就扮演了命名空间的角色。具体举个例子,文件 foo.txt 可以同时在目录/home/greg 和 /home/other 中存在,但在同一个目录中不能存在两个 foo.txt 文件。另外,在目录 /home/greg 外访问 foo.txt 文件时,我们必须将目录名以及目录分隔符放在文件名之前得到 /home/greg/foo.txt。这个原理应用到程序设计领域就是命名空间的概念。”——命名空间概述

浅解用PHP实现MVC

MVC是一个老生常谈的问题,是为了解决一类共同问题总结出来的一套可复用的解决方案,这是软件设计模式产生的初衷。不管是客户端还是移动端,MVC的分层设计模式解决了软件开发中的可复用、单一职责、解耦的问题,PHP语言中的MVC设置模式也是如此。下面通过PHP语言细说MVC模式如何在PHP中应用,本文主要从如下几方面介绍:

O MVC的工作原理

O PHP开发框架

a) 开发框架的优势

b) 使用框架进行模块划分

O 一个简单MVC框架总体架构分析

谈谈大家对PHP框架的各种误解

有人认为,PHP是每次请求都要初始化资源,这个开销非常大。由此,PHP不适合使用开发框架。

对于PHP,确实没有类的持久化,使得每次请求都要初始化资源,但是,这并不是开销的主要问题所在。最主要的问题,是在于开发PHP框架的人,对PHP本身的特性了解多少。最简单的,MVC需要检测UA,如果使用PHP自带的get_browser函数,那肯定是死定了。因为,使用上的方便与简单,导致的是性能的开销。

认为不可使用PHP开发框架的,还有的观点是:由于需要每次请求的时候初始化整个框架。其实,这也是一种误解。如果好好看看PHP源码,就会了解,PHP是按请求加载需要运行的文件,并不是整个框架。所以,对于框架本身,哪一种框架内核代码时越小,性能越好。

如何主导设计一个亿级高并发系统架构-数据存储架构(三)


架设一个亿级高并发系统,是多数程序员、架构师的工作目标。 许多的技术从业人员甚至有时会降薪去寻找这样的机会。但并不是所有人都有机会主导,甚至参与这样一个系统。这个系列我们通过虚构一个这样的系统,一步步来完善我们的架构理念。

分享:六个绝佳的PHP模板引擎

对于良好的可维护性的中型项目(在我看来是超过4个页面),对页面的逻辑视图进行分隔是至关重要的。在一个有着几个页面的应用程序,使用 Php?>在页面中插入包含的所有必要逻辑可能就足够了,但是当使用一个路由器的时候,找到一个好的模板引擎是很重要的。下表列举的六个绝佳的PHP模板引擎可能会助你一臂之力。

Smarty算是一种很老的PHP模板引擎了,它曾是我使用这门语言模板的最初选择。虽然它的更新已经不算频繁了,并且缺少新一代模板引擎所具有的部分特性,但是它仍然值得一看。

控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言